Research On Classification And Planning Index Of Urban Local Road Network

There are certain differences in transportation efficiency,traffic allocation,traffic accessibility,and land use between different road network models.Only by fully understanding the road network structure characteristics can various road network models be better applied.This article makes a statistical analysis of the road network parameter indicators in different urban areas,studies the composition of the road network spatial structure and explores the structural characteristics of typical road network models,which provides a scientific theoretical basis for road network planning.The specific research contents are summarized as follows:First,through statistical analysis of local road network samples in 15 different urban areas(suburbs),it is found that the differences in geometric layout and topological characteristics between networks mainly come from these planning indicators: the number and type of intersections,the density and grade of road networks structure,proportion of cul-de-sac roads,number and proportion of continuous roads,connectivity and depth values,etc.And the road network model is divided into square grid network,rectangular structure network,Tree-type structure network and cul-de-sac network.Then,based on the above four types of local road network structures,the axis model based on spatial syntax and the traffic accessibility model based on GIS platform are established respectively.Under the quantitative analysis technology,the road network patterns with different structural characteristics show different spatial characteristics: The closer to the "Net" structure,the better the analysis of the path Depth,Integration,Choice,Intelligibility,and traffic accessibility index values;the closer to the "Tree" structure,the path The distribution of Depth value,Choice value and traffic accessibility are quite different.The key design indicators that affect these differences mainly include the distribution of backbone roads in the road network,the connectivity of the road network,the classification of road grades,the ratio of interpenetrating roads,and the density index of bus lines.Finally,by comparing various index factors related to road traffic characteristics,the differences between different road network modes are analyzed,the traffic characteristics of various road network modes are interpreted.Besides,the optimal design method is proposed for the shortcomings of each road network mode and use examples to verify the results of its optimized design.According to the influencing factors of the development of the urban road network layout model,the design principles and reasonable applicable areas of the typical road network model are analyzed from the two structural characteristics of "Tree" and "Net".
